So, after St Albans and a very cool day, a new PB was delivered. Excellent.

A month on and hit the NSPCC Half Marathon.

The weather was unforgiving. Averaging somewhere close to 90F the sun beat down on all 2000 runners and water seemed all to scarce. Onlookers with hosepipes sprayed us as we went by. That didn't stop a good few people crashing out with heat exhaustion. I'm glad to say I wasn't one of them and that most finished. I don't believe anyone smashed any records, I think peoples main goal was to finish.
